LYRA RF Antennas (S-band / Ka-band)
High-reliability S-band and Ka-band antennas for satellite TT&C, EO downlink, and ISL — 4 models, RHCP/LHCP configurable, 7 to >20 dBi gain. Applications: SAR, EO, GNSS, broadband comms.
Technical specifications
- Models
- S-band Air Gap, S-band Pin Feed, S-band Array, Ka-band Array
- S-band frequency
- 2200–2290 MHz
- Ka-band frequency
- 27–31 GHz
- S-band Air Gap gain
- >= 7 dBi
- S-band Array gain
- > 18 dBi
- Ka-band Array gain
- > 20 dBi @ 29 GHz
- Ka-band HPBW
- 10 deg @ 29 GHz
- Polarization
- RHCP or LHCP (configurable)
- Return loss
- < -10 dB (all models)
About
NewSpace Systems’ LYRA antenna range offers configurable RHCP or LHCP polarization across four models spanning S-band and Ka-band frequencies. Models range from a wide-beam 70-degree HPBW S-band patch antenna through to a high-gain 10-degree HPBW Ka-band array. All variants deliver better than -10 dB return loss across their respective bands. Applications span TT&C, SAR, Earth observation downlink, deep-space links, broadband communications, and GNSS positioning and timing. The range is designed to meet stringent satellite and aerospace reliability requirements.
